RA-1
Single Family Districts, Very Low Density
The purpose of these districts is to set aside and protect areas which have been or may be developed predominantly for single family dwellings on large Lots in a rural setting. Certain other uses are also permitted as-of-right or by Special Permit subject to adequate conditions and safeguards. It is intended that all uses permitted in these districts be compatible with single family Development and consistent with local Street characteristics, the use and protection of private water and sewer facilities (where public facilities are unavailable) and the level of other public services. it is hereby found and declared, further, that these regulations are necessary to the protection of these areas and that their protection is essential to the maintenance of a balanced community of sound residential area of diverse types.
